OVER 30-YEAR WAIT ENDS AS RPT PERAJURIT BIDOR NAME RESTORED

12/01/2026 10:07 PM

TAPAH, Jan 12 (Bernama) -- Residents of Rancangan Perkampungan Tersusun (RPT) Perajurit Bidor can finally refer to the settlement by its official name after the Perak government formalised its recognition, ending over three decades of confusion caused by the dual use of RPT Perajurit Bidor and Taman Sri Bidor.

State Housing and Local Government Committee chairman Sandrea Ng Shy Ching said the decision resolves long-standing discrepancies between land titles and official documents such as addresses, taxes and utilities for the ex-military residents.

“Land was granted by the Sultan of Perak to former military personnel in 1987 and developed as a planned village in the early 1990s, but from 1994, Taman Sri Bidor was used in some local authority matters,” she told reporters after the official renaming ceremony at Dewan Taman Sri Bidor today.

Ng said the move preserves the village’s historical identity, ensures uniformity in official records and recognises the contributions of former military residents, with coordination from the Tapah District Council, Tapah District and Land Office, and related agencies.

Meanwhile, Perak Malaysian Armed Forces Veterans Association president Mazlan Umar welcomed the decision as a mark of respect for around 50 veterans, aged 60 to 70, who currently live in the 0.8-hectare planned village.
